A New Terror Threat?

Within hours of the Oct. 29 triple bombing that killed 62 and injured 210 in New Delhi, Indian security services fingered Lashkar-e-Toiba ("Army of the Pure"), a Pakistan-based militant group with links to al Qaeda. On Nov. 10, authorities arrested Tariq Ahmed Dar, a Kashmiri toiletries salesman whom authorities have accused of masterminding the attacks for LeT, and last week announced the arrest of two more men from the Kashmiri capital Srinagar. If the arrests aren't surprising, they are no less troubling.
